The Jasmine House is a striking classic beach bungalow. Centrally located in Wrightsville Beach, the home is just a short walk from both the famed Johnnie Mercer pier, and the bustling downtown stores and eateries on the island!

The top level of the duplex has 3 bedrooms and 1 attractively refreshed full bathroom. The home sleeps 6 people comfortably, and has 2 queen beds and 1 twin bed with a twin trundle bed underneath. The kitchen is supplied with everything you will need during your stay, and the shaded top decks are ideal for calming out of the sun. The backyard also has sitting areas for get togethers and is a terrific place to watch our marvelous sunsets.

The top level back deck has peek-a-boo vistas of the Banks Channel waterway, and just 3 homes down you will find the public sound access that is a ideal put in spot for kayaks or stand up paddle boards. One block in the other direction you will find yourself standing at the beach access!

Rental property booking tips:

When to reserve a Cape Fear area rental & When to go:

  • Reserve your rental as early as possible. Rental schedules usually open tw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rental homes during Winter holiday g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• June, July, and August are the most expensive months in coastal NC. To find the largest rental home for your budget, we recommend reserving in the Fall or Spring. You'll enjoy lower rates, greater selection, warm weather and the absence of large crowds at Cape Fear area restaurants, beaches, and activities.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Cape Fear area v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ation near the ocean? Christmas, Thanksgiving, and New Years Eve are great times to gather with family and friends at your favorite beach.
  • Some property managers offer promotional rates for veterans. Ask your host or property manager if rate reductions are available for your group.
  • Property management companies frequently offer customers an option to obtain trip insurance.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ed time as a result of personal medical-related catastrophes or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unexpected hotel or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for specifics.
  • Many management companies and vacation rental houses supply Cape Fear area area visitor guide magazines which will include special offers, either offered directly by local businesses, or through a relationship with the management company and the business itself. You can also find visitors guide and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

Use filters to narrow your search:

  • Choose a group leader, choose your vacation week, and choose a budget.
  • Note the number bedrooms and what type of bedroom configuration you need. Jasmine House Upper - 3bedroom\/1 bath cottage on Wrightsville Beach has 3 bedrooms and 1 bathrooms.
  • Precise information about bedrooms and bed counts & types is regularly available online. If they are not listed, email the property owner before you book the home. Remember that most listings specify the max. guest capacity, which usually includes pull-out couches. You will need to work out what configuration is right for your vacation.
  • Traveling with pets? Although a number of vacation homes allow pets or animals, guidelines and costs vary per property. Type of pet, size and breeds may be limited. Make sure to ask before booking, and study your agreement thoroughly! Additional fees or could be applied to your contract.
  • If there's a particular Cape Fear area attraction you love, search for rentals that are either close by, or those that cater especially to your needs.
  • Appropriate accessibility amenities can make or break a vacation for the less-mobile. Make certain to inquire about wheel chair entry, pool lifts and specialized equipment needs.

Have a great stay:

  • Take a copy of the property manager's contact number and arrival/departure procedures for your rental property.
  • Hosts are great sources of help! Don't be shy to ask any questions before, during, or after your stay.
  • Protect the owner (and your stuff!) by locking the rental when you are away, just like you would at home.
  • To make sure that damages aren't attributed to your family's stay, make a record of any problem areas upon check in. text the property manager right away to relay your findings.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having a record of issues and contact attempts will be helpful.
  •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like obnoxious visitors disrupting your quiet neighborhood. Practice the golden rule for best judgement. If they like you, locals might even recommend great beaches and scenic spots you would have never otherwise known!
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Neighbors can typically help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to order the best nachos, have a great night out, or the best spots for shopping?
  • Don't leave anything behind! Just before departing, walk through the rental to reconfirm you've collected everything. Re-check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den items. Clean the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Inspect the property one final time and look for damages to contents or the property itself. We recommend walking through with the host wh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the property manager isn't available, remember to take video of the property to record its condition at check-out.
  • After your trip, leave a review! Hosts rely on excellent ratings to stimulate new reservations. They'll be grateful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something went awry, other vacationing families will will be grateful for your feedback find their best rental home.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the host could control the issue, and if so, whether they responded expeditiously to remedy it.

The former, as described by Lanier, is the more commercialized of the two destinations and features a boardwalk, outdoor dining options and a plethora of weekly activities including fireworks, live music, amusement park pop-ups, and movies under the stars. Kure Beach offers a more residential feel with its fishing pier, intimate restaurants and family favorite, North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her.More water fun awaits, too. “There is a harbor and a canal that feed into the intercoastal.
